主题 : 定时任务生成静态任务 无效
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
1#   发表于:2015-06-16 16:26:10  IP:218.66.*.*
环境: linux red hat  oracle10 
页面取时间的方式  dateFormat='yyyy-MM-dd'    ${b.releaseDate?string(dateFormat)}
异常信息如下:
java.text.ParseException: Unparseable date: "Jun 16, 2015"
at java.text.DateFormat.parse(DateFormat.java:357)
at com.jeecms.common.util.DateFormatUtils.parseDate(DateFormatUtils.java:42)
at com.jeecms.cms.service.CmsSiteFlowCacheImpl.visitPages(CmsSiteFlowCacheImpl.java:239)
at com.jeecms.cms.service.CmsSiteFlowCacheImpl.flow(CmsSiteFlowCacheImpl.java:95)
at com.jeecms.cms.action.front.CmsSiteFlowAct.flowStatistic(CmsSiteFlowAct.java:23)
at sun.reflect.GeneratedMethodAccessor726.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:606)
at org.springframework.web.bind.annotation.support.HandlerMethodInvoker.invokeHandlerMethod(HandlerMethodInvoker.java:176)
at org.springframework.web.servlet.mvc.annotation.AnnotationMethodHandlerAdapter.invokeHandlerMethod(AnnotationMethodHandlerAdapter.java:440)
at org.springframework.web.servlet.mvc.annotation.AnnotationMethodHandlerAdapter.handle(AnnotationMethodHandlerAdapter.java:428)
at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:925)
at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:856)
at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:936)
at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:827)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:624)
at org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:812)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:731)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:303)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at com.jeecms.common.web.XssFilter.doFilter(XssFilter.java:46)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at org.apache.shiro.web.servlet.AbstractShiroFilter.executeChain(AbstractShiroFilter.java:449)
at org.apache.shiro.web.servlet.AbstractShiroFilter$1.call(AbstractShiroFilter.java:365)
at org.apache.shiro.subject.support.SubjectCallable.doCall(SubjectCallable.java:90)
at org.apache.shiro.subject.support.SubjectCallable.call(SubjectCallable.java:83)
at org.apache.shiro.subject.support.DelegatingSubject.execute(DelegatingSubject.java:383)
at org.apache.shiro.web.servlet.AbstractShiroFilter.doFilterInternal(AbstractShiroFilter.java:362)
at org.apache.shiro.web.servlet.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:125)
at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:343)
at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:260)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at org.springframework.orm.hibernate3.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:230)
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at com.jeecms.common.web.ProcessTimeFilter.doFilter(ProcessTimeFilter.java:35)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:220)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:122)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:505)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:170)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:957)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:423)
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1079)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:620)
at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:318)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Thread.java:745)
16:01:00.018 ERROR org.quartz.core.JobRunShell - Job DEFAULT.3979fad9-8044-4074-9bd6-a251dc594afc threw an unhandled Exception: 
java.lang.NumberFormatException: null
at java.lang.Integer.parseInt(Integer.java:454) ~[na:1.7.0_60]
at java.lang.Integer.parseInt(Integer.java:527) ~[na:1.7.0_60]
at com.jeecms.cms.task.job.IndexStaticJob.executeInternal(IndexStaticJob.java:40) ~[IndexStaticJob.class:na]
at org.springframework.scheduling.quartz.QuartzJobBean.execute(QuartzJobBean.java:113) ~[spring-context-support-3.2.6.jar:3.2.6.RELEASE]
at org.quartz.core.JobRunShell.run(JobRunShell.java:202) ~[quartz-1.6.0.jar:1.6.0]
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:529) [quartz-1.6.0.jar:1.6.0]
16:01:00.018 ERROR org.quartz.core.ErrorLogger - Job (DEFAULT.3979fad9-8044-4074-9bd6-a251dc594afc threw an exception.
org.quartz.SchedulerException: Job threw an unhandled exception.
at org.quartz.core.JobRunShell.run(JobRunShell.java:213) ~[quartz-1.6.0.jar:1.6.0]
at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:529) [quartz-1.6.0.jar:1.6.0]
Caused by: java.lang.NumberFormatException: null
at java.lang.Integer.parseInt(Integer.java:454) ~[na:1.7.0_60]
at java.lang.Integer.parseInt(Integer.java:527) ~[na:1.7.0_60]
at com.jeecms.cms.task.job.IndexStaticJob.executeInternal(IndexStaticJob.java:40) ~[IndexStaticJob.class:na]
at org.springframework.scheduling.quartz.QuartzJobBean.execute(QuartzJobBean.java:113) ~[spring-context-support-3.2.6.jar:3.2.6.RELEASE]
at org.quartz.core.JobRunShell.run(JobRunShell.java:202) ~[quartz-1.6.0.jar:1.6.0]
... 1 common frames omitted
级别: 总版主
UID: 10736
积分:148518 加为好友
威望: 205 精华: 42
主题:287 回复:126219
注册时间:2010-09-08
在线时长:18.17
2#   发表于:2015-06-16 16:29:49  IP:220.9.*.*
定时任务器的时间格式是怎么设置的
路漫漫其修远兮,吾将上下而求索!
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
3#   发表于:2015-06-16 16:33:17  IP:218.66.*.*
执行周期 间隔 1 分钟
级别: 总版主
UID: 10736
积分:148518 加为好友
威望: 205 精华: 42
主题:287 回复:126219
注册时间:2010-09-08
在线时长:18.17
4#   发表于:2015-06-16 16:35:03  IP:220.9.*.*
把你后台配置截图看下
路漫漫其修远兮,吾将上下而求索!
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
5#   发表于:2015-06-16 16:37:02  IP:218.66.*.*
静态化页面配置截图
级别: 版主
UID: 70293
积分:78391 加为好友
威望: 1 精华: 0
主题:7 回复:68397
注册时间:2014-12-03
在线时长:0
6#   发表于:2015-06-16 16:38:45  IP:220.9.*.*
你静态首页不行吗,你页面上有时间不和规范
1
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
7#   发表于:2015-06-16 16:40:06  IP:218.66.*.*
页面取时间的方式  dateFormat='yyyy-MM-dd'    ${b.releaseDate?string(dateFormat)} 
级别: 版主
UID: 70293
积分:78391 加为好友
威望: 1 精华: 0
主题:7 回复:68397
注册时间:2014-12-03
在线时长:0
8#   发表于:2015-06-16 16:42:05  IP:220.9.*.*
还有别的吗,检查一下
1
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
9#   发表于:2015-06-16 16:44:57  IP:218.66.*.*
静态页面手动生成  可以正常显示  但是定时任务无效,还有你看那个异常信息,如果时间不是这样取,还有其它方式?
级别: 举人
UID: 76303
积分:129 加为好友
威望: 9 精华: 0
主题:13 回复:102
注册时间:2015-06-03
在线时长:0
10#   发表于:2015-06-16 16:45:42  IP:218.66.*.*
每次生成静态页,后台都会报上面的异常信息
1 2 > >| 共2页